Port City Music Hall $2 Tuesdays featuring Pete Kilpatrick Band and The Coloradas

Port City Music Hall continues to please the music lovers of Portland with their $2 Tuesdays and this coming week, Tuesday, January 25, the crowds will flock to PCMH to listen to the great Pete Kilpatrick Band and The Coloradas. Enjoy a manageable $2 cover charge and $2 brews. This is a 21+ event.

Old Orchard Beach BBQ at The Ballpark Today – July 17

Courtesy of OOB365.com

Saturday, July 17, from 1pm to 6pm come visit the Old Orchard Beach Ballpark for the Best BBQ around with well known BBQ’ers who know how it’s done and sure to keep the mouth watering like, Pig Out, Alabama’s BBQ , Acadian Smokehouse, Chaisin the Ring, Pig B-Q Roasts, New England Brisketeers, Famous Dave’s, and Jimmy The Greeks.

A $10 ticket gets you into the ballpark to sample the flavor-filled works of each of the competitors while having a seat in the stadium and listening to musical performances. Those set to perform include; Pete Kilpatrick Band, Beyond Reason, Anni Clark, and Lynn Deeves. There will be a bounce house for the kids and horseshoe pits as well to add to the entertainment and fun. The event will last until 6pm this evening, just in time to head towards the beach for more fun!

‘Live and Local’ Taping at The Empire – April 29, 30, and May 1

Courtesy of Scott Hamann

Calling all music enthusiasts! Are you interested in supporting local acts and seeing the creation of a new television show highlighting local music acts in and around Portland? We love everything local here at ILovePortlandMaine.com and recently received word of a new weekly half-hour TV show called “Live and Local” that will be broadcast statewide in Maine, and showcase different Maine bands each week. For those music enthusiasts who wish to see the show creation in action, the creator, Scott Hamann tells me that the show will be taping the upcoming season on April 29, April 30, and May 1 at The Empire Dine and Dance, 575 Congress Street, Portland. The show will air every Sunday on WPXT. Nine bands will perform over the weekend and include; Thursday, April 29: $6 Dead Man’s Clothes | Holy Boys Danger Club | Ruin Friday, April 30: $10 Lost on Liftoff | Grand Hotel | The Sophomore Beat Saturday, May 1: $10 Pete Kilpatrick Band | Zach Jones Band | Lady Lamb the Beekeeper For Tickets and additional Show Information visit: LiveAndLocalMe.com

Old Port Festival – Downtown Portland – June 7, 2009

OldPortFestival

Sunday, June 7th, marks the 36th Annual Old Port Festival in Portland, Maine
, and what a way to celebrate and welcome Summer to Portland than music, art, entertainment, and more. Something for all ages and a wonderful time rain or shine. The City of Portland in conjunction with many area businesses, have coordinated a number of sites and stages for different local and national musical acts to entertain the crowd, while they check out crafts from local artists and shop the wonderful stores of The Old Port. The streets will surely be filled from Congress St. to Commercial Street, between Temple/Union St. and Pearl St. for another awesome festival. There will be plenty of food and outdoor activities for all to enjoy!

Thriving Ivory, Elliot Yamin (finalist on previous American Idol), Dar Williams, Pete Kilpatrick, and Kelly Parker are just some of the many entertainers to perform across a number of different stages. There are performances and events for kids too.
